Nikolai Svanidze answers the questions of “domestic notes”.
Who is watching your historical programs, are you counting on a specific audience?
Sociometric measurements were not made, but I do not see great need for them. In all my programs, I always counted on people who are not too lazy to think. It can be both a teenage girl, and a retired man, a man with a higher education or a rustic carpenter.
Do you deliberately use modern clip technologies? Do you have a deliberate tradition of "pictures"?
Fashion in television, as in other areas of life, comes and goes away, and, in the end, healthy conservatism triumphs. Clip technologies are designed for a youth audience, and they can annoy the elderly. In addition, I believe that in clip technologies there is a certain frivolity of the presentation, which is not combined with seriousness, drama and even the tragedy of the material. I do not see the possibility of such a combination.
What are the general principles of building a transmission?
Firstly, this is a very high density of the material-at the limit of perception possibilities. I understand that there is a risk of misunderstanding, but I want to squeeze as much as possible into the program, because the story is richest, there are a great many facts. And the second: we are not time. There is not a single fact that would be overwhelmed. Naturally, we can’t tell about everything that was happening in all the ends of a huge country over the whole year in forty -four minutes. But we are not time.
What are the principles of selection of heroes, plots?
Here I try to be objective and be guided by the criteria for the scale of the personality or the scale of the deed, which is far from always the same.
Recently, your hero was a berry ...
Yes, he is a large -scale figure, three heads above Yezhov, whom we do not take at all as a character. The berry is comparable by scale with Beria. He led the NKVD for a very long time, did a lot of terrible things, but he is interesting. In our series there are personalities with a plus sign, and with a minus sign. I can love them or not love them. But the berry undoubtedly significantly influenced what Russia was in the 20th century.
From what image of our history do you repel and what do you want to bring the viewer to?
In the series "Historical Chronicles" we are engaged almost exclusively by Soviet history. Only a small part is devoted to the beginning of the century. In our society, there is nostalgia for Soviet times. This is primarily nostalgia for a huge empire. People tend to wear her in different beautiful clothes. Here everyone was together, everyone was friends, loved each other, and now they do not like. Nostalgia is an emotion. People sometimes sad simply in their youth. This is generally the property of memory - to hold the bright sides of life. Therefore, many are now tended to nostalgically recall the Soviet Union, clouding in memory what was bad. With this myth I struggle, relying on the facts. At the rational level, it is not necessary to be sad about the Soviet Union, it was really the fruit of the October Revolution and at the same time inherited the worst traditions of the Russian Empire. This synthesis was finally fixed under Stalin. But the Soviet Union showed the whole world a path that cannot be going. This is his huge historical role.
There is another reason for nostalgia for the Soviet Union. He was completely unmotivated in his citizens with a mania of greatness: we are huge, we are afraid of us, respect us, we are the first country of socialism, we, we, we ... we are the best, we have the happiest children ... And now, after the defeat in the Cold War, after the collapse of the USSR, this whole system of completely baseless self -love has collapsed. And people remember the former - then they respected us, but now not, then we were afraid, but now not. The Swiss are not sad about the fact that they are not afraid of them ...
But this nostalgia is a consequence of a stereotypical idea of its past, about Russia, which it should be.
We have no other serious concept of the past, which would be accepted by the patriotic. Although Nikolai Alekseevich Nekrasov said best about patriotism: "Who lives without sadness and anger, he does not like his homeland." This is the patriotism, in my opinion, and not to be proud of his own stupidity, their own mud. The most common pseudopatriotic concept is that Russia is an empire, and if not an empire, then not Russia. We can be ourselves only if we live in an empire, otherwise, disappear all the loss. This concept seems to me deeply false, and I try to fight it on the example of the history of Russia of the 20th century. My task is to show the truth about this story in all its terrible nudity.
I have another super -task - to accustom people to the perception of history. Now the danger is very great that the new generations of our fellow citizens, our children, will completely lose a sense of history. Many of them have such an attitude as if it all started this morning. And before that, there were fools who could not tell us anything, because they did not reach anything, and idiots-devers, about whom we know nothing at all, and we don’t want to know. Now, after all, the socio-hierarchical staircase is turned upside down: many young people are more rich and socially protected than their parents, which cannot be in a normal society. Respect for the older generations falls-and why respect them? Respect for history falls-what was valuable there?
I want people to love history, so that they understand: followed by many generations of their ancestors, followed by powerful layers of great culture. It is necessary that people know - in Russia there was a great spiritual culture. The regime that we had in the 20th century, largely opposed this culture, burned it and succeeded in it.
And another task, closely related to the previous one, is just to accustom people to look back. After all, it is known that if you shoot the past from the pistol, she will respond with a shot from the gun. You need to know the story, know it as it was. There is such a science - history. I strive to ensure that people treat history seriously and perceive it not as a set of jokes, but as their past. But in order to love this story, you need to read something, watch. I want us to love our story even in a terrible form, because it is believed that it can be loved only if it is clean and immaculate, like a young maiden. This does not happen.
Our history is tragic partly because since the time of Karamzin is understood exclusively as the history of the state.
This question is complicated. Because the history of Russia is really the history of the state. There are objective reasons for this and, above all, a huge territory. The vastness of the territory has always led to the strengthening of the central authority in order to hold these lands with steel scraps so that they would not spread, like a cave -free dough. All the last centuries, the main task of the authorities was to maintain the territory. The one who managed to expand it was a great sovereign. And how much he put his people for this, did not matter. This is a given of our history. Therefore, the history of Russia is the history of the Russian state. This is not good and not bad, it is so.

After the abolition of serfdom, when the country slowly followed the path of bourgeois, democratic transformations, there was a threat of Russia entering the Western cultural and social-economic project. And the forces that opposed this path - it does not matter how they called themselves - could not endure it. The revolution was not a jump forward, but a fall. She delayed the transformation of Russia for a whole century.

Do you see other historical broadcasts on TV?
How do you feel about them? When my project was being prepared, everyone asked: well, it will look like Parfenovsky? When several episodes came out, they stopped comparing. It is ridiculous to compare red with round. Parfenov is a very talented television designer, he works amazingly with the form. For me, the content is much more important. These are completely different sports. And I think that both are needed, "let one hundred colors bloom."
Recently, transfers built on secret materials on the history of intelligence have gained great widespread ...
It can be curious to watch. But this is not mine. I try in my project to fight the theory of conspiracies - in the broad sense of the word. But it is difficult to fight her, the theory of conspiracies is seductive with its ease. No need to look for reasons, delve into the sources. Everything is simple. Lenin received money from the German General Staff through Parvus and made a revolution. But the reasons are much deeper. Even if the conspiracy took place, it must be embedded in historical fabric, and not say that it is all the matter. It is ridiculous to say that the First World War began only because the Archduke Ferdinand was killed. It has not therefore begun, although without a Sarajev murder, maybe it would have begun differently. It is also ridiculous to believe that three people in the Belovezhskaya Pushchal collapsed the Soviet Union. If he himself was not ready to fall apart, they would not have such a task on the shoulder.
